Origin: inferior Pubic Rami (19)

Insertion: Linea Aspera on the posterior surface of the femur (15)

Actions: Adduction and External Rotation of the femur, it joins to produce the Flexion of the thigh on the hip

Helping Synergist Muscles:

  • together with Adductor Longus, Adductor Magnus and Gracilis (4)  acts to produce the Adduction of the thigh
  • together with other Adductors muscles, posterior fibers of Gluteus Maximus and Gluteus Minimus, Sartorius, Ileopsoas (1) and Piriformis acts to produce the External Rotation of the thigh

Notes: the Adductor Brevis is immediately deep to the Pectineus (2) and Adductor Longus
